What is the primary significance of the abbreviation SOB in emergency situations?

Explanation:
The abbreviation SOB primarily signifies "Shortness of Breath," especially in emergency medical contexts. This term is clinically vital as it indicates a patient's potential respiratory distress, which could arise from various conditions such as asthma attacks, pneumonia, or exacerbations of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D). Recognizing shortness of breath is crucial for medical professionals because it prompts immediate assessment and intervention to ensure the patient's airway, breathing, and circulation are stable. In emergency medicine, timely identification of shortness of breath allows healthcare providers to initiate appropriate treatments, such as supplemental oxygen or bronchodilators, thus significantly impacting patient outcomes. Understanding this abbreviation empowers medical scribes and professionals to document patient symptoms effectively and communicate urgent patient needs to the healthcare team.
